Utz Quality Foods is seeking a
VP, Sales Operations: West to join our Sales team. Leading the sales teams in assigned geographies, the Vice President of Sales Operations creates and executes sales strategies; ensures the achievement of Sales Objectives in a sustainable and profitable manner; analyzes and prepares sales forecasts; attracts, retains and develops top talent; ensures that the team has an excellent working relationship with all customers and Independent Operators/Distributors; protects and grows market share; improves Direct Store Delivery, DSD, route capacity by achieving route split objectives and sales center upgrades; and ensures that safety is a priority.
